[−] List of all items
Structs
- ErgoTree
- ErgoTreeConstantsParsingError
- ErgoTreeRootParsingError
- ast::Constant
- ast::ConstantPlaceholder
- ast::RegisterId
- ast::TryExtractFromError
- chain::Base16DecodedBytes
- chain::Base16EncodedBytes
- chain::Digest32
- chain::Digest32Error
- chain::address::AddressEncoder
- chain::context_extension::ContextExtension
- chain::contract::Contract
- chain::data_input::DataInput
- chain::ergo_box::BoxId
- chain::ergo_box::BoxValue
- chain::ergo_box::ErgoBox
- chain::ergo_box::ErgoBoxAssetsData
- chain::ergo_box::ErgoBoxCandidate
- chain::ergo_box::NonMandatoryRegisterIdParsingError
- chain::ergo_box::NonMandatoryRegisters
- chain::ergo_box::box_builder::ErgoBoxCandidateBuilder
- chain::ergo_state_context::ErgoStateContext
- chain::input::Input
- chain::input::UnsignedInput
- chain::prover_result::ProverResult
- chain::token::Token
- chain::token::TokenAmount
- chain::token::TokenId
- chain::transaction::Transaction
- chain::transaction::TxId
- chain::transaction::unsigned::UnsignedTransaction
- eval::Env
- eval::ReductionResult
- serialization::constant_store::ConstantStore
- serialization::op_code::OpCode
- serialization::sigma_byte_reader::SigmaByteReader
- serialization::sigma_byte_writer::SigmaByteWriter
- serialization::types::TypeCode
- sigma_protocol::Challenge
- sigma_protocol::DlogProverInput
- sigma_protocol::GroupSizedBytes
- sigma_protocol::dlog_group::EcPoint
- sigma_protocol::dlog_protocol::FirstDlogProverMessage
- sigma_protocol::dlog_protocol::SecondDlogProverMessage
- sigma_protocol::fiat_shamir::FiatShamirHash
- sigma_protocol::fiat_shamir::FiatShamirHashError
- sigma_protocol::prover::TestProver
- sigma_protocol::sigma_boolean::ConversionError
- sigma_protocol::sigma_boolean::ProveDHTuple
- sigma_protocol::sigma_boolean::ProveDlog
- sigma_protocol::sigma_boolean::SigmaProp
- sigma_protocol::unchecked_tree::UncheckedSchnorr
- sigma_protocol::unproven_tree::UnprovenSchnorr
- sigma_protocol::verifier::TestVerifier
- sigma_protocol::verifier::VerificationResult
- wallet::Wallet
- wallet::box_selector::BoxSelection
- wallet::box_selector::SimpleBoxSelector
- wallet::tx_builder::TxBuilder
Enums
- ErgoTreeParsingError
- ast::BoxMethods
- ast::CollMethods
- ast::CollPrim
- ast::ConstantColl
- ast::ConstantVal
- ast::ContextMethods
- ast::Expr
- ast::PredefFunc
- ast::ops::BinOp
- ast::ops::NumOp
- chain::address::Address
- chain::address::AddressEncoderError
- chain::address::AddressTypePrefix
- chain::address::NetworkPrefix
- chain::ergo_box::BoxValueError
- chain::ergo_box::ErgoBoxFromJsonError
- chain::ergo_box::NonMandatoryRegisterId
- chain::ergo_box::NonMandatoryRegistersError
- chain::ergo_box::box_builder::ErgoBoxCandidateBuilderError
- chain::prover_result::ProofBytes
- chain::token::TokenAmountError
- chain::transaction::TransactionFromJsonError
- eval::EvalError
- serialization::serializable::SerializationError
- sigma_protocol::FirstProverMessage
- sigma_protocol::PrivateInput
- sigma_protocol::ProofTree
- sigma_protocol::prover::ProverError
- sigma_protocol::sig_serializer::SigParsingError
- sigma_protocol::sigma_boolean::SigmaBoolean
- sigma_protocol::sigma_boolean::SigmaProofOfKnowledgeTree
- sigma_protocol::unchecked_tree::UncheckedLeaf
- sigma_protocol::unchecked_tree::UncheckedSigmaTree
- sigma_protocol::unchecked_tree::UncheckedTree
- sigma_protocol::unproven_tree::UnprovenLeaf
- sigma_protocol::unproven_tree::UnprovenTree
- sigma_protocol::verifier::VerifierError
- wallet::WalletError
- wallet::box_selector::BoxSelectorError
- wallet::secret_key::SecretKey
- wallet::signing::TxSigningError
- wallet::tx_builder::TxBuilderError
Traits
- ast::StoredNonPrimitive
- ast::TryExtractFrom
- chain::ergo_box::ErgoBoxAssets
- chain::ergo_box::ErgoBoxId
- eval::Evaluator
- serialization::serializable::SigmaSerializable
- serialization::sigma_byte_reader::SigmaByteRead
- serialization::sigma_byte_writer::SigmaByteWrite
- sigma_protocol::ProofTreeLeaf
- sigma_protocol::ProverMessage
- sigma_protocol::prover::Prover
- sigma_protocol::verifier::Verifier
- util::AsVecU8
- util::FromVecI8
- util::IntoOption
- wallet::box_selector::BoxSelector
Functions
- chain::blake2b256_hash
- chain::ergo_box::checked_sum
- chain::ergo_box::sum_tokens
- chain::ergo_box::sum_tokens_from_boxes
- chain::ergo_box::sum_value
- serialization::ergo_box::parse_box_with_indexed_digests
- serialization::ergo_box::serialize_box_with_indexed_digests
- sigma_protocol::dlog_group::exponentiate
- sigma_protocol::dlog_group::generator
- sigma_protocol::dlog_group::identity
- sigma_protocol::dlog_group::inverse
- sigma_protocol::dlog_group::is_identity
- sigma_protocol::dlog_group::random_element
- sigma_protocol::dlog_group::random_scalar_in_group_range
- sigma_protocol::dlog_protocol::interactive_prover::compute_commitment
- sigma_protocol::dlog_protocol::interactive_prover::first_message
- sigma_protocol::dlog_protocol::interactive_prover::second_message
- sigma_protocol::dlog_protocol::interactive_prover::simulate
- sigma_protocol::fiat_shamir::fiat_shamir_hash_fn
- sigma_protocol::fiat_shamir::fiat_shamir_tree_to_bytes
- sigma_protocol::sig_serializer::parse_sig_compute_challenges
- sigma_protocol::sig_serializer::serialize_sig
- wallet::signing::sign_transaction
- wallet::tx_builder::new_miner_fee_box